To assist in the manufacture of Printed Folded Cartons to the required specification, in line with business and customer objectives.

The primary purpose of this role is to set and run cut & crease machinery against the prescribed quality standards & customer specifications supplied, ensuring that a health and safety focus is maintained at all times.

Responsibilities:

· Prepare all relevant material components to operate the machine throughout the shift. This involves heavy lifting and manual handling of large items

· Maintain optimum speeds for the machine while at the same time ensuring customer quality standards are met

· Segregation of work using manual, dextrous processes

· Pushing and pulling of loaded pallets onto and off the machine using a lifting device

· Lifting tooling, dies and stripping equipment onto the machine and into a storage area using high access platforms

· Ensure the machine is maintained in good mechanical working order meeting all Company standards

· Responsible for ensuring that the housekeeping of machinery and the working area is maintained to the required standard

· Be responsible for both product and mechanical fault finding while operating
